Brunton Surname Meaning

From Where Does The Surname Originate? meaning and history

This surname is derived from a geographical locality. 'of Brunton,' two townships in the parish of Gosforth, Northumberland But no doubt often 'of Brampton,' which see, compare Brunwin and Brumwin.

Adam de Brunton, Salop, 20 Edward I: Placita de Quo Warranto, temp. Edward I-III.

1773. Married — Joseph Wheatley and Elizabeth Brunton: St. George, Hanover Square.

A Dictionary of English and Welsh Surnames (1896) by Charles Wareing Endell Bardsley

Local. There is a Brunstane on Brunstane Burn, Midlothian, and there is a village of Brunton in the parish of Criech, Fife. Stodart says Walter of Burntoun held part of Luffness in the reign of Robert III (II, p. 329), John Brountoun was tenant of Aliebank Selkirkshire, 1558 (ER., XIX, p. 421), James Bruntoun of Calfhill, Roxburghshire, 1660 (RRM., I, p. 285), and James Bruntoun in Boongate of Jedburgh, appears in 1746 (Heirs, 211). George Brunton, miscellaneous writer, was born in Edinburgh, 1799. Brentoun and Brountoun 1584, Birnetoune 1504; Brantoun, Brenton, Bromton, Brwntoun. Brunton near Embleton Northumberland is = Burnton, with metathesis of r.

The Surnames of Scotland (1946) by George Fraser Black (1866-1948)

(English) belonging to Brunton = 1 the Burn or Brook Farm [Old English brunna, burne, a brook + tún] 2 Brun(a)’s Farm or Manor [Anglo-Saxon pers. name Brun(a-brún, brown]

Surnames of the United Kingdom (1912) by Henry Harrison

Two townships in Northumberland.

Patronymica Britannica (1860) by Mark Antony Lower

A location name in Fife.

British Family Names: Their Origin and Meaning (1903) by Henry Barber

How Common Is The Last Name Brunton? popularity and diffusion

The surname is the 47,634th most commonly used last name at a global level. It is borne by approximately 1 in 671,230 people. The surname occurs predominantly in Europe, where 37 percent of Brunton live; 36 percent live in Northern Europe and 36 percent live in British Isles. It is also the 2,136,160th most frequently held forename worldwide, borne by 25 people.

It is most commonly occurring in The United States, where it is carried by 3,118 people, or 1 in 116,247. In The United States Brunton is most common in: California, where 16 percent reside, Indiana, where 6 percent reside and Texas, where 5 percent reside. Outside of The United States Brunton is found in 50 countries. It also occurs in England, where 24 percent reside and Australia, where 13 percent reside.

Brunton Family Population Trend historical fluctuation

The frequency of Brunton has changed through the years. In The United States the number of people carrying the Brunton last name rose 808 percent between 1880 and 2014; in England it rose 199 percent between 1881 and 2014; in Scotland it contracted 2 percent between 1881 and 2014; in Ireland it rose 132 percent between 1901 and 2014 and in Wales it rose 683 percent between 1881 and 2014.
